Detailed Description
USBHost class This class is a singleton.
All drivers have a reference on the static USBHost instance

void init | ( | ) | [protected, inherited] |
Initialize host controller.
Enable USB interrupts. This part is not in the constructor because, this function calls a virtual method if a device is already connected
